Could the Bs being in the S&P 500 be part of this?

It doesn't seem so--they have been in the index for some years now, and the ratio was pegged extremely close to 1500:1 for the first few years after that.
In fact, it was closer to 1500 after the index inclusion than it was years previously. The "old normal" for a long time (prior to the credit crunch, say) was about 1502.
